Computational and Experimental Studies of Ablation Effect on Electronic Characteristics in Vehicle Wake

Abstract:

This study was implemented for satisfying the demand of aerodynamic physics applications. On incoming flow conditions of a highenthalpy arc wind tunnel, the polypropylene ablation effect on electron density in a vehicle wake was investigated both computationally and experimentally. Numerical results agree well with the relevant experimental ones, and the numerical precision of electron density is largely improved with no more than one magnitude error.
